AngularJS Routing - 무엇이 필요합니까?

· 8년 전 · 1409
AngularJS Routing - 무엇이 필요합니까?

응용 프로그램을 라우팅 할 수 있도록하려면 AngularJS Route 모듈을 포함해야합니다.

<script src="https://ajax.googleapis.com/ajax/libs/angularjs/1.6.4/angular-route.js"></script>
그런 다음 ngRoute애플리케이션 모듈에 종속물로 추가해야합니다.

var app = angular.module("myApp", ["ngRoute"]);
이제 애플리케이션은를 제공하는 라우트 모듈에 액세스 할 수 $routeProvider있습니다.

을 사용 $routeProvider하여 애플리케이션에서 다른 경로를 구성하십시오.

app.config(function($routeProvider) {
$routeProvider
.when("/", {
templateUrl : "main.htm"
})
.when("/red", {
templateUrl : "red.htm"
})
.when("/green", {
templateUrl : "green.htm"
})
.when("/blue", {
templateUrl : "blue.htm"
});
});
어디로 가나 요?
응용 프로그램에는 라우팅에서 제공하는 내용을 넣을 컨테이너가 필요합니다.

이 컨테이너가 ng-view지시어입니다.

ng-view응용 프로그램에 지시문 을 포함시키는 세 가지 다른 방법이 있습니다 .

예:
<div ng-view></div>

예:
<ng-view></ng-view>

예:
<div class="ng-view"></div>

응용 프로그램에는 하나의 ng-view지시문 만있을 수 있으며이 지시문은 경로에서 제공하는 모든보기에 대한 자리 표시 자입니다.
|
댓글을 작성하시려면 로그인이 필요합니다. 로그인

퍼블리싱강좌

+
분류 제목 글쓴이 날짜 조회
부트스트랩 8년 전 조회 1,078
부트스트랩 8년 전 조회 1,457
부트스트랩 8년 전 조회 1,342
부트스트랩
[부트스트랩]
8년 전 조회 1,260
부트스트랩
[부트스트랩]
8년 전 조회 1,252
부트스트랩
[부트스트랩]
8년 전 조회 1,392
부트스트랩
[부트스트랩]
8년 전 조회 1,256
부트스트랩 8년 전 조회 1,584
부트스트랩 8년 전 조회 1,570
부트스트랩
[부트스트랩]
8년 전 조회 1,814
부트스트랩 8년 전 조회 2,727
AngularJS
[AngularJS]
8년 전 조회 1,482
AngularJS
[AngularJS]
8년 전 조회 1,139
AngularJS
[AngularJS]
8년 전 조회 1,011
AngularJS 8년 전 조회 1,410
AngularJS 8년 전 조회 1,214
AngularJS 8년 전 조회 1,523
AngularJS 8년 전 조회 1,469
AngularJS 8년 전 조회 1,443
AngularJS 8년 전 조회 1,374
AngularJS 8년 전 조회 1,245
AngularJS 8년 전 조회 1,425
AngularJS 8년 전 조회 1,074
AngularJS 8년 전 조회 1,276
AngularJS 8년 전 조회 1,283
AngularJS 8년 전 조회 1,640
AngularJS
[AngularJS]
8년 전 조회 1,390
AngularJS
[AngularJS]
8년 전 조회 1,609
AngularJS 8년 전 조회 1,578
AngularJS
[AngularJS]
8년 전 조회 1,671
🐛 버그신고